Meaning & origin
Timberlyn is a modern invented name first recorded in the United States in 1995. It reached its peak popularity in 2017, when it ranked higher than in any other year, though it has remained rare throughout its history. As of 2025, Timberlyn ranks 11,932, a position indicating steady but very low usage, with just 1 in every 229,610 newborn girls receiving the name. The name has no documented top states of usage, suggesting it is spread thinly across the country rather than concentrated in any region. Its etymology is transparently modern: a combination of the nature word 'timber' with the popular suffix '-lyn,' reflecting the broader American trend of creating distinctive, nature-inspired names. Timberlyn has no historical or traditional origins, nor is it derived from any established language. It belongs to the 2010s decade naming cohort, a period that saw many similar invented names.
